One of the key factors in choosing your next best new driver is getting the right loft angle. The loft of the driver, between 7.5 and 14 degrees, influences the ball flight’s trajectory along with the design, shaft bend, and, among other things, you! Web29 sep. 2015 · So, if you start with a closed face angle and square the face at impact you are in fact adding loft. Lets walk through how that happens. If you change our SureFit Tour hosel setting to A4 you mechanically add 1.5 degrees of loft to our driver.
